Output dfa57907cf1323a493db90f1f8f1fdea5c9f52b430dc3c3bd13c848c85380f7d:12

value
21400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9f02813e5ee0d93afaaa58a106b39c216dc769 OP_EQUAL
address
ACe6UyfXCJYpvgPM8A9bpci69CUo6j78qu
transaction
dfa57907cf1323a493db90f1f8f1fdea5c9f52b430dc3c3bd13c848c85380f7d